An anti-theft alarm is a device that prevents unauthorized entry into a vehicle through sounding an alarm if the vehicle detects any tampering or change in location when parked.

A safety feature that improves the handling of a vehicle by detecting skids and compensating by adjusting braking pressure. This in turn helps maintain the intended direction of the vehicle.

Tires that be can driven on with minimal pressure for a certain number of kilometers. Vehicles fitted with run flat tires allow drivers to safely reach the nearest petrol station without the need for stopping immediately during a flat or puncture.

A safety feature that uses a combination of cameras and sensors to warn drivers if they are drifting out of their marked lanes. This is usually done through an audio/visual warning.
